Support/Panels for some older models will discontinue over time.

Originally Posted by -justin-
Yes we will continue to provide replacement panels for some older models (just like we do now), but as time moves forward we simply can't support EVERY model, especially the older ones.

Just thought this bit of insight from Justin of Martin Logans marketing department warrants it's own thread.
